ORDER OF OPERATIONS
1.
2.
3.
4.
Brackets - ( ) or [ ]
Exponents or Powers
Multiply and Divide (from left to right)
Add and Subtract (from left to right)

Evaluating a Variable Expression
To evaluate a variable expression:
1. substitute the given numbers for each
variable.
2. use order of operations to solve.
